1. Add all ingredients except the honey and lemon juice to the inner liner of the pressure cooker.
2. Place lid on and set the steam release knob to the Sealing position.
3. Press the Pressure Cook (or Manual) button or dial and then the +/- button or dial and select 15 minutes. When the cook cycle finishes, turn off the pot so it doesn't go to the Warming setting. Let it fully Naturally Release the pressure.
4. Open the lid and take out the inner pot and strain the liquid into a glass bowl to cool.

1. Place elderberries, water, cinnamon sticks, ginger and vanilla into an Instant Pot.
2. Zest the orange and the lemon. Juice the lemon and orange and place them both into the IP. Throw the remaining orange and lemon into the pot after juicing. As it cooks, it will melt down and all the parts of the fruit will flavor the syrup.
3. Seal the Instant Pot and set it to “MANUAL” on “HIGH PRESSURE” for 7 minutes.
4. Once the timer goes off, set the valve to “VENT” and strain the mixture into a sieve over a bowl. Squeeze the mixture through the sieve with the back of the spoon until no more liquid comes out. Discard the remaining berries and citrus.

1. Combine all ingredients except manuka honey in pressure cooker.
2. Set for 9 minutes on high pressure.
3. Vent pressure and strain into a large vessel.
4. Once cooled, add honey and stir until well combined.

1. Add all of the ingredients to a medium saucepan and bring to a boil.
2. Re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es.
3. Blend with an immersion blender (or transfer to a blender) until mostly smooth.
4. Strain through a fine strainer into a clean bowl and then pour through a funnel into a clean glass jar. Store in the refrigerator for up to one month or freeze for up to 3 months.
